高效率去重 真2024年3月7日17时50分56秒

admin 头条 1

如果您需要从文本中高效去重,以下是一些常用的方法和步骤:

1. 使用文本编辑器或编程语言:

文本编辑器:一些文本编辑器如Notepad++或Sublime Text有查找和替换功能,可以快速找到重复的文本。

编程语言:Python、Java等编程语言都有处理文本和数据去重的库,例如Python中的`pandas`库可以方便地处理大型数据集的去重。

2. 使用在线工具:

有许多在线文本去重工具,只需将文本粘贴到这些工具中,它们会自动找出并删除重复的内容。

3. 手动去重:

如果文本量不大,可以手动检查并删除重复的内容。

以下是一个简单的Python代码示例,使用集合(set)来去除字符串中的重复字符:

```python

original_text = "真2024年3月7日17时50分56秒真2024年3月7日17时50分56秒"

使用集合去除重复字符

unique_characters = set(original_text)

将集合转换回字符串

unique_text = ''.join(unique_characters)

print(unique_text)

```

这段代码会输出不包含重复字符的字符串。

如果您需要去除文本中的重复行,可以使用以下Python代码:

```python

假设text_lines是一个包含多行的字符串列表

text_lines = [

"真2024年3月7日17时50分56秒",

"真2024年3月7日17时50分56秒",

"这是另一行文本"

]

使用集合去除重复行

unique_lines = list(set(text_lines))

如果需要保持原始顺序,可以使用以下方法

unique_lines_ordered = []

seen = set()

for line in text_lines:

if line not in seen:

unique_lines_ordered.append(line)

seen.add(line)

print(unique_lines_ordered)

```

这段代码会输出一个不包含重复行的列表,同时保持了原始的顺序。